  • Problems write in I / O with VISA series (low speed of the program being recorded)

    Hello! I've been monitoring voltage speed of the serial port 230000 baud / s. It is fast and accurate, but when I want to save this data to a tmds, xls, txt file, reduce the speed of the program and buffer overflows in series, which reduces the voltage rate control information. I tried on 2 PC with four core processors. I think that it is not because of the PC.

    Because of what it might be?

    File IO is SLOW.  You must compensate for that somewhere.  Look at the producer/consumer.  The idea here is to have a loop that simply reads the serial port (as fast as it should) and use a queue to pass data to another loop to process and save to disk.

  • Store problems under Windows.

    Store OT:Windows 8.

    I am not so much with store windows 8, I need to update my applications, tried everything I just want to know in plain language

    How to uninstall windows store and reinstall windows store once again, I opened the store windows and it keeps all loading, it does not open

    can someone help please!

    To begin, start here: http://windows.microsoft.com/en-PH/windows-8/what-troubleshoot-problems-app. If the problem persists try by running the following commands from a command prompt (Admin)

    (1) sfc/scannow when you have completed delivery to zero meter Running.

    (2) Dism.exe. / /ScanHealth/Cleanup-Image Online

    (3) Dism.exe/online/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th once finished restart and run sfc/scannow, if necessary. Also you can try to reset the cache to store; Windows key + W, click Run, type wsreset.exe, type. Hope this helps and if you need any additional aid station and we will be happy to help you.
